Bessemer Trust
Lead Software Engineer
This job is now closed
Job Description
- Req#: 2335
- Lead the design, development, and deployment of high-quality software solutions using React, AWS, and modern scripting languages.
- Drive architecture decisions to ensure scalability, performance, and maintainability.
- Collaborate with product managers and stakeholders to translate business requirements into technical specifications.
- Leverage AWS services for application development, including database management, serverless computing, and cloud storage solutions.
- Optimize performance and cost-efficiency of applications hosted in AWS.
- Ensure security best practices in cloud-based development.
- Oversee API design, development, and management to support seamless integration across systems.
- Ensure APIs adhere to performance, scalability, and security standards.
- Design and implement automated CI/CD pipelines to streamline development workflows.
- Optimize release processes to improve delivery speed and reduce errors.
- Lead and mentor a team of engineers, fostering a culture of collaboration, innovation, and technical excellence.
- Promote best practices in coding, testing, and deployment across the team.
- Utilize expertise in scripting languages such as TypeScript, JavaScript, and Python to deliver robust software solutions.
- Ensure cross-platform compatibility and performance optimization.
- Work closely with cross-functional teams, including Business Solution Engineers, QA, and business stakeholders, to ensure successful project delivery.
- Clearly communicate technical concepts to non-technical audiences.
- Bachelor’s degree in computer science, or a related field.
- 10+ years of experience in software engineering and design.
- Proficient in React for building responsive, user-centric web applications.
- Hands-on cloud experience with AWS services such as Lambda.
- Experience working with AWS databases (e.g., DynamoDB, Redshift) optimizing for performance and scalability.
- Strong knowledge of designing, developing, and managing APIs on platforms like WSO2, REST and GraphQL.
- Advanced skills in TypeScript, JavaScript, and Python for software development and scripting.
- Familiarity with Agile/Scrum frameworks for managing and delivering projects.
- Familiarity with CI/CD pipelines using tools like BitBucket, Docker and Terraform.
- Effective communication and collaboration skills to work with cross-functional technology teams, including software engineers, solution engineers, infrastructure engineers, and architects
- Demonstrated experience leading engineering teams and mentoring junior developers.
- Problem-solving and decision-making abilities
- Cloud certifications preferred
- Expertise in one or more wealth management disciplines, such as portfolio management and trading, client advisory services, or modern corporate finance practices
Join a leading wealth management firm dedicated to delivering cutting-edge digital solutions that empower employees and clients. As a Software Engineering Lead, you will play a pivotal role in driving the development and delivery of innovative, scalable, and secure applications that support the firm’s strategic objectives. Your expertise in front-end and back-end development, cloud infrastructure, and automation will guide a high-performing team to build transformative digital products.
Primary Responsibilities:
Technical Leadership
Cloud Development
API Development & Integration
Continuous Integration & Deployment (CI/CD)
Team Leadership & Mentorship
Scripting and Development
Collaboration & Communication
Qualifications:
About the company
Privately owned and independent, Bessemer Trust is a multifamily office that has served individuals and families of substantial wealth for more than 110 years.
Notice
Talentify is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or protected veteran status.
Talentify provides reasonable accommodations to qualified applicants with disabilities, including disabled veterans. Request assistance at accessibility@talentify.io or 407-000-0000.
Federal law requires every new hire to complete Form I-9 and present proof of identity and U.S. work eligibility.
An Automated Employment Decision Tool (AEDT) will score your job-related skills and responses. Bias-audit & data-use details: www.talentify.io/bias-audit-report. NYC applicants may request an alternative process or accommodation at aedt@talentify.io or 407-000-0000.